				when is this a fault..............
			 
			
			a blocker reaches over the net and contacts the ball completely on the opponents side of the net. this is a fault when........... A > WHEN THE BALL IS FALLING NEAR THE NET AND, IN THE REFEREE'S JUDGEMENT, NO OPPONENT IS NEAR ENOUGH TO MAKE A PLAY ON THE BALL B > DURING SIMULTANEOUS CONTACT WITH THE OPPONENTS ATTACK HIT C> AFTER AN ATTACK BY THE OPPONENT D> AFTER THE THIRD HIT BY OPPONENTS |
